Group decision-making is a type of participatory process in which multiple individuals act
collectively, analyse problems or situations, consider and evaluate alternative courses of
action, and select from among the alternatives a solution or solutions. The basic
philosophy behind using a group to make decisions is captured by the adage, "Two heads
are better than one".
